tschins

Mòcheno

Etymology

From Middle High German zins, from Old High German zins (tax, tribute, interest on a lease or rent), from Latin cēnsus (census). Cognate with German Zins (interest).

Noun

tschins m

  1. rent
    Mu i hom a kòmmer as tschins?Can I have a room for rent?
